The tradition of using silk or satin on tuxedo lapels emerged in the 1860s. It offered a fresh alternative to the velvet collars, cuffs and facings popular on formal wear during the English Regency period.

When it comes to tuxedos, there are three different types of vents. In the center-vent single, the seam has a lower opening, and there is a single vent slit in the back. With the side-vent type, there are two different openings in the lower seam, and the two in the back are double-vented. In the non-vented kind, there are no openings.

Keep in mind you will be wearing suspenders (braces) with your tuxedo. The classic look is white to match the dress shirt, but black is acceptable. If your tux is a color other than black, a complementary color may work.

The tuxedo was a revolutionary style that modernized formal wear by inspiring men to replace traditional tailcoats with the more casual shortened dinner jackets back in 1886. It is still the most stylish formal wear for men to this day.

Did you know that the original dinner jackets were made without vents? Later, side vents emerged, which provided easier access to trouser pants. Common today is the single or center vent, although tux aficionados consider it in poor taste, as when a man reaches into his trouser pockets, it exposes the seat of his pants.

When it comes to tuxedos, a "besom pocket" refers to a fabric or satin strip that’s been sewn on top of the pocket. With a double besom, two strips are present: one over the pocket opening and one on top of the pocket.

It may seem strange, but beeswax used to be a common substance used by tailors in the production of suits. It was sometimes added to thread to give it additional weight and strength.
